What is the largest Latino groups in the US?

The largest Latino group in the US are individuals of Mexican descent, followed by Puerto Ricans and people of Cuban descent.

What is the largest group of Latinos living in washingtonD.C.?

The largest group of Latinos living in Washington, D.C., is of Salvadoran descent. This community has significantly influenced the cultural and social landscape of the city. Other notable Latino groups include Mexicans, Puerto Ricans, and Dominicans, but Salvadorans form the largest demographic within the Latino population in the area.
